加入收藏 | 设为首页 | 会员中心 | 我要投稿 李大同 (https://www.lidatong.com.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

简单可靠的内存数据库,用于支持JPA的快速java集成测试

发布时间:2020-12-12 16:15:25 所属栏目:MsSql教程 来源:网络整理
导读:如果我使用内存数据库而不是PostgreSQL,我的集成测试将运行得更快.我使用JPA(Hibernate),我需要一个内存数据库,可以轻松地切换到使用JPA,易于安装和可靠.由于我不想采用我的数据访问代码进行测试,所以需要相当广泛地支持JPA和Hibernate(或者相反的话). 什么数
如果我使用内存数据库而不是PostgreSQL,我的集成测试将运行得更快.我使用JPA(Hibernate),我需要一个内存数据库,可以轻松地切换到使用JPA,易于安装和可靠.由于我不想采用我的数据访问代码进行测试,所以需要相当广泛地支持JPA和Hibernate(或者相反的话).

什么数据库是上述要求的最佳选择?

解决方法

对于集成测试,我现在使用我喜欢HSQLDB的 H2(来自HSQLDB的原作者).它是 faster(我希望我的测试尽可能快),它有一些很好的功能,如 compatibility模式,开发团队是非常敏感的(而HSQLDB多年保持休眠,直到最近).

(编辑:李大同)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章
      热点阅读